Aluminum tubing and framing extrusions are essential parts in building and construction and manufacturing markets. These extrusions are produced with a procedure where light weight aluminum billets are warmed and forced through a shaped die to produce the preferred cross-sectional account. The outcome is light-weight yet solid components that are used for every little thing from structural supports in buildings to framework for industrial machinery.

Among the vital benefits of light weight aluminum tubes and mounting extrusions is their flexibility. They can be personalized in regards to measurements, wall surface density, and alloy composition to meet particular demands. This versatility makes them appropriate for a wide variety of applications where stamina, longevity, and deterioration resistance are important. For instance, in building, aluminum tubing is typically utilized in frameworks for windows, doors, drape wall surfaces, and roof covering trusses as a result of its light-weight nature and capability to stand up to extreme climate condition.

In production, aluminum mounting extrusions work as the foundation for constructing machines, conveyor systems, and various other devices. The capability to easily link and assemble these extrusions using fasteners and accessories such as T-slot nuts and brackets boosts their use and flexibility in commercial settings. This modularity permits quick modifications and expansions as production requires modification, promoting performance and cost-effectiveness in making procedures.

Aluminum U channels and F channels are versatile extruded profiles utilized in different applications across industries. U channels feature a U-shaped cross-section with flanges on either side, while F channels have an F-shaped cross-section with a solitary flange along one side. These accounts are made use of for bordering, framing, reinforcement, and structural support in construction, manufacturing, and fabrication projects.

In construction, aluminum U channels and F networks are generally made use of for bordering and framing applications such as completing exposed edges of panels, reinforcing edges, and producing structural frameworks for doors, home windows, and cladding systems. Their light-weight yet long lasting nature makes them simple to manage and set up, decreasing labor costs and construction time.

Manufacturers and makers worth aluminum U networks and F networks for their design flexibility and deterioration resistance. These accounts can be customized in regards to measurements, alloy structure, and surface area coatings to satisfy specific task demands. Powder-coated or anodized surfaces can be used to light weight aluminum channels to improve sturdiness, aesthetics, and resistance to put on and rust.

T-Slot Aluminum Systems

T-slot light weight aluminum systems, additionally called modular light weight aluminum mounting systems or light weight aluminum extrusion systems, are functional remedies for creating equipment frames, workstations, enclosures, and various other frameworks. These systems include light weight aluminum profiles with T-shaped slots on multiple sides, allowing for easy assembly and reconfiguration using fasteners and devices such as T-slot nuts, screws, and braces.

One of the primary advantages of T-slot aluminum systems is their modularity and adaptability in layout. Customers can conveniently link and construct light weight aluminum accounts to create customized configurations that meet specific size, shape, and functionality requirements. This adaptability makes T-slot systems appropriate for a wide variety of applications in manufacturing, automation, robotics, and industrial machinery.

T-slot light weight aluminum accounts are offered in different sizes, forms, and alloy structures to fit different lots abilities and structural demands. Typical profiles consist of standard T-slot accounts with multiple slots for versatile assembly, heavy-duty accounts for robust applications, and specialized accounts with special attributes such as shut faces or integrated circuitry channels for enhanced capability.

Aluminum square tubes are hollow extruded profiles with a square-shaped cross-section, supplying stamina, adaptability, and lightweight residential or commercial properties. These tubes are made use of in building, manufacturing, and manufacture markets for architectural support, structure, and ornamental applications. Light weight aluminum square tubes are created through the extrusion procedure, where aluminum billets are heated and required via a shaped die to create the wanted profile.

Among the key benefits of aluminum square tubes is their high strength-to-weight ratio, that makes them excellent for applications where lightweight materials are essential without compromising structural integrity. The square-shaped cross-section provides excellent torsional strength and resistance to flexing, making light weight aluminum square tubes appropriate for building frames, supports, and units in industrial and building setups.

Aluminum square tubes are available in various measurements, wall surface densities, and alloy make-ups to satisfy particular project needs. They can be reduced, drilled, bonded, and machined utilizing conventional tools and strategies, permitting simple customization and setting up. Typical applications include structure for conveyor systems, machinery frameworks, furniture parts, and architectural structures such as hand rails and balustrades.
